Immunohistochemistry (Paraffin) Enhanced Validation - Recombinant Antibody Technology Formalin Fixed Paraffin Embedded (FFPE) human small intestine (A) and Negative control (B) tissue sections were prepared using heat-induced epitope retrieval (HIER). Immunostaining was performed using a 1:100 dilution of Cat. No. ZRB1415, Anti-Nucleolin, clone 5D13 ZooMAb® Rabbit Monoclonal. Reactivity was detected using an Goat Anti-Rabbit IgG and HRP-DAB. Nuclear staining was observed in glandular cells & lamina propria of human small intestine tissue sections.

Immunogen: KLH-conjugated linear peptide corresponding to 16 amino acids from the N-terminal region of human Nucleolin.

Target description: Nucleolin (UniProt: P19338; also known as Protein C23) is encoded by the NCL gene (Gene ID: 4691) in human. Nucleolin is a multifunctional phosphoprotein that is ubiquitously distributed in the nucleolus, nucleus and cytoplasm of the cell. It is one of the most abundant non-ribosomal proteins that accounts for about 10% of the protein content within the nucleolus. It is found associated with intra-nucleolar chromatin and pre-ribosomal particles. It plays important roles in various steps of ribosomal synthesis, including the transcription of rDNA repeats, the modification and processing of pre-rRNA, the assembly of pre-ribosomal particles and nuclear-cytoplasmic transport of ribosomal proteins and subunits. Nucleolin contains three structural and multifunctional domains: the N-terminal domain contains several acidic stretches; two to four RNA-binding domains (RNA recognition motifs or RRM) in the central region; and a glycine/arginine-rich domain (GAR) domain at the C-terminus. Nucleolin is shown to be highly phosphorylated. It undergoes extensive phosphorylation by casein kinase 2 at interphase and by CDC2 during mitosis. It has been reported that Nucleolin phosphorylation at interphase is correlated with active rRNA transcription. Although the mammalian Nucleolin has a predicted molecular weight of about 77 kDa, its apparent molecular weight lies between 100 and 110 kDa due to highly phosphorylated amino acids in the N-terminal domain.
